句柄无效如何恢复?

编辑:自学文库 时间:2024年03月09日
如果句柄无效,可以尝试以下步骤来恢复: 1. 检查代码中是否存在错误或错误的句柄使用方式。
  如果句柄无效,可能是因为它被错误地释放或关闭了。
  确保在使用句柄之前,它已被正确地初始化并且没有被意外地关闭或释放。
   2. 如果句柄无效是因为资源被意外释放,可以尝试重新打开或重新分配资源,以使句柄有效。
  此过程通常需要先释放资源,然后重新分配和初始化资源,并将句柄重新关联到资源上。
   3. 确保程序具有适当的错误处理机制。
  如果句柄无效是由于外部因素,如资源被删除或不可用,程序应该能够捕获并处理这些错误情况,而不会导致崩溃或不可预知的行为。
   4. 在某些情况下,可能需要重启应用程序或重新启动计算机来解决句柄无效的问题。
  这是因为句柄无效可能是由于系统资源不足或其他系统级问题造成的,重启可以清除这些问题。
   总之,当句柄无效时,需要仔细检查代码中的错误以及资源的使用情况,并确保正确处理错误情况。
  适当的错误处理和合理的资源管理是解决句柄无效问题的关键。